Building a Thriving Remote Team: Recruitment Strategies

Attracting and retaining top talent in the remote setting can be challenging but beneficial. To build a high-performing remote team, it's crucial to implement effective talent acquisition strategies. Start by explicitly defining your expectations and crafting compelling job postings that highlight the advantages of working remotely. Leverage digital platforms like LinkedIn, remote websites, and social media to attract with a wider pool of candidates. Consider offering appealing salaries and benefits packages to motivate skilled professionals to join your team.

Foster a positive remote atmosphere by investing in communication technologies that facilitate seamless interaction. Provide opportunities for team members to network and build connections, even remotely. Conduct regular discussions to evaluate progress, address challenges, and celebrate achievements. By implementing these strategies, you can create a thriving remote team that is successful.

Finding Your Perfect Remote Fit: Skills and Culture Match

Landing a remote job that's the perfect fit for you requires more than just having the right skills. It also means matching with a company culture that appeals to your work style and values. To maximize your chances of finding that dream remote role, take some time to consider your individual needs and preferences.

  • Evaluate Your Skills: What are you truly good at? Identify your talents and look for roles that utilize them.
  • Explore Company Cultures: Don't just focus on the job description. Explore company websites, skim employee reviews, and reach out to current or former employees to get a feel for their work environment.
  • Express Your Preferences: During the application process, highlight your remote work experience and describe what type of culture you thrive in.

Remember, finding the perfect remote fit is a two-way street. By staying true to yourself and your requirements, you'll increase your odds of landing a remote job that fulfills you.
